The North Central Texas Council of Governments (NCTCOG) is a voluntary association of by and for local governments and was established to assist local governments in planning for common needs cooperating for mutual benefit and coordinating for sound regional development. NCTCOGs purpose is to strengthen both the individual and collective power of local governments and to help them recognize regional opportunities eliminate unnecessary duplication and make joint decisions. Since 1974 NCTCOG has served as the Metropolitan Planning Organization for transportation in the Dallas-Fort Worth Metropolitan Area and is responsible for developing transportation plans and programs that address the complex needs of the rapidly growing area. The planning area for transportation includes the 12 counties of Collin Dallas Denton Ellis Hood Hunt Johnson Kaufman Parker Rockwall Tarrant and Wise. NCTCOG also serves as a designated recipient for Federal Transit Administration funds.
